vue-cli-service inspect 可以使用vue-cli-service inspect来审查一个 Vue CLI 项目的 webpack config。 查看可用命令 有些CLI 插件会向vue-cli-service注入额外的命令。例如@vue/cli-plugin-eslint会注入vue-cli-service lint命令。 查看所有注入的命令:npx vue-cli-servicehelp 学习每个命令可用的选项:npx vue-...
webpack.DefinePlugin又是什么呢? webpack.DefinePlugin是webpack自带的一个插件,它的作用是在编译的时候生成一些全局变量的,这里说的全局变量指的是客户端的全局变量,相当于挂载在window对象上的变量,我们可以利用它的这个功能在不同的环境(开发,测试,或者生产)当中定义不同的行为。 官方介绍与使用 介绍完两个插件了...
isProduction &&newMiniCssExtractPlugin({filename:"static/css/[name].[contenthash:10].css",chunkFilename:"static/css/[name].[contenthash:10].chunk.css", }),newVueLoaderPlugin(),newDefinePlugin({__VUE_OPTIONS_API__:"true",__VUE_PROD_DEVTOOLS__:"false", }),// 按需加载element-plus组件样...
webpack.DefinePlugin是webpack自带的一个插件,它的作用是在编译的时候生成一些全局变量的,这里说的全局变量指的是客户端的全局变量,相当于挂载在window对象上的变量,我们可以利用它的这个功能在不同的环境(开发,测试,或者生产)当中定义不同的行介绍完两个插件了,是时候说一下两者结合在实际当中如何使用了。 下面将...
请注意,只有NODE_ENV,BASE_URL和以VUE_APP_开头的变量将通过webpack.DefinePlugin静态地嵌入到 客户端...
vue-cli构建项目详解 简介:vue是什么,是一套构建用户界面的渐进式框架。vue两大核心思想,组件化和数据驱动,组件化就是把一个整体拆分个一个一个的组件,组件可重复使用。数据驱动是前端未来的发展方向,释放了对DOM的操作,让DOM随着数据的变化而自然的变化,不必过多的关注DOM,只需要将数组组织好即可。
vue-cli有两个文件夹和一个文件是项目配置和启动的关键: build文件包含了脚手架在开发环境和生产环境下webpack配置。 config文件包含了build文件下webpack具体配置的值,根据不同环境区分build文件夹下面的不同文件 package.json: 整个项目安装的依赖包以及配置基础信息和启动信息 build文件夹: build.js check-versions...
一、vue-cli介绍 vue-cli是一个用于快速搭建vue项目的 脚手架。 二、vue-cli安装、更新 安装过nodeJs 、cnpm 后,全局安装vue-cli(以后其他项目可直接使用): 代码语言:javascript 代码运行次数:0 运行 AI代码解释 cnpm install -g vue-cli 更新: 代码语言:javascript 代码运行次数:0 运行 AI代码解释 cnpm upda...
vue-cli是构建vue单页应用的脚手架,输入一串指定的命令行从而自动生成vue.js+wepack的项目模板。这其中webpack发挥了很大的作用,它使得我们的代码模块化,引入一些插件帮我们完善功能可以将文件打包压缩,图片转base64等。后期对项目的配置使得我们对于脚手架自动生成的代码的理解更为重要,接下来我将基于webpack3.6.0版本...
new webpack.DefinePlugin({ 'process.env.NODE_ENV': JSON.stringify('production') }) Vue CLI项目: 在vue.config.js中确保已设置NODE_ENV为production: module.exports = { // 其他配置... chainWebpack: config => { config.plugin('define').tap(definitions => { ...